Real estate firm plans arena, expo center in Naperville

A new arena and expo center to be built in Naperville will seat 4,500 and host two ice rinks. The rinks can both be turned into basketball courts or convention floors. Read the full story.

Ceramic bowls, chili fight hunger at CLC

Ceramic bowls and chili were the tools used to fight hunger Wednesday during College of Lake County's annual Empty Bowls fundraiser. Students studying ceramics and foods preparation teamed up for the event that has raised about $52,000 over the 10-year period, ceramics teacher David Bolton said. Full story.
